This is because the womb stretches the muscle mass in the abdomen to fit your expanding baby. One research study located that approximately 60 percent of ladies may experience diastasis recti during pregnancy or postpartum. The mountain climber should not be utilized in place of your daily stroll as this is necessary to your recovery as well as alignment changes that are vital to helping to achieve solid and properly working core. You ought to wait a minimum of 6 weeks following a vaginal birth without complications, as well as at the very least 10 weeks following a c-section or any birth difficulties, before starting the Intensive workouts in the 12 Week Program.
